- "Mukul" means a soul or a flower in bud. Osho's second magazine, published in Jabalpur. First is Prayas (प्रयास).
- language
- Hindi
- notes
- Editors: Rajneesh and his friends Hari Krishna Tripathi and Baijnath Sharma.
- ISSN
- time period of publication
- 1952 to 1953

Mukul (मुकुल)
- Date of publication : 1953
- Volume :
- Issue / no. : 3
- Edition notes : From the content: On Kahil Gibran. Osho: My Thoughts (on destroying the old to create the new). On Ghandhiism. Osho: Life, Death and Nature. Jokes. Poems. Letters to the editor, all letters written and answered by Osho himself. Including advertisements. (Source: Osho Source Book)
